1. Algorithmic Trading

Algorithmic trading, powered by AI and ML, has revolutionized financial markets. These technologies enable the analysis of vast datasets at incredible speeds. Here, AI and ML algorithms identify patterns and execute trades in milliseconds. These AI-driven algorithms adapt to changing market conditions.

As a result, it allows financial institutions to continuously learn and optimize trading strategies. By automating buy and sell decisions, algorithmic trading reduces human errors, minimizes emotional biases, and enhances market liquidity. Traders can leverage historical and real-time data to make more informed decisions.

Consequently, it maximizes profits and minimizes risks. Hence, this algorithmic trading is empowering traders and financial companies more efficient, data-driven, and responsive to market dynamics.

2. Credit Scoring and Risk Assessment

Traditional credit scoring models often rely on limited data. They have limited resources to accurately analyze the credit and risk associated with financial services. Therefore, many times leads to incomplete financial assessment. However, AI and ML have brought about a paradigm shift in credit scoring and risk assessment within the finance industry.

With AI, current financial models can incorporate a diverse range of data sources, including non-traditional ones like social media activity and online behavior. Besides this, machine learning algorithms analyze this extensive dataset. By deploying ML models in fintech applications business owners can identify useful patterns. They can also find correlations to assess an individual’s creditworthiness more accurately.

Thus, this approach not only expands financial inclusion by evaluating individuals with limited credit histories but also improves risk management for lenders. Hence, the dynamic nature of ML models enhances the precision of credit decisions and reduces the likelihood of defaults.

3. Enhanced Fraud Detection and Prevention

Conventional fintech apps or financial applications often struggle to keep up with the evolving tactics of fraudsters. Especially in the present age when cyber security becoming more crucial, banks, investors, and financial companies have to invest a lot in building fintech applications with advanced features. In this case, AI and ML help them as a powerful tool in making a secure financial app or software.

This is because artificial intelligence and machine learning models excel at identifying anomalies and patterns indicative of fraudulent behavior. By analyzing large volumes of transactional data in real-time, these systems can detect irregularities. For instance, unusual spending patterns or unauthorized access, and trigger immediate responses.

Moreover, ML models continually learn from new data. It enables the application or system to adapt to emerging threats and fraud techniques. Hence, the result is a robust and proactive approach to fraud detection. It not only saves financial institutions from significant financial losses but also safeguards the trust and confidence of customers in the security of their financial transactions.

6. Robo-Advisors

Robo-advisor is one of the top trends in fintech app development. Many companies and business organizations utilize AI-powered robo-advisors for plenty of purposes. The robo-advisors have democratized access to investment advice and portfolio management.

They analyze user preferences, risk tolerance, and financial goals to provide automated and data-driven investment advice. Robo-advisors leverage sophisticated machine learning models to continuously learn from market trends.

They use historical data to optimize portfolio allocations. As they eliminate human biases and emotions from investment decisions, robo-advisors offer a systematic and disciplined approach to wealth management. Top Examples of Companies That Used AI and ML in Finance

1. UBS

It is a global financial services company that utilizes AI for wealth management. They leverage machine learning to analyze market trends, assess risks, and provide personalized investment advice to their clients.

2. Robinhood

Robinhood is one of the famous investment apps. It is a commission-free stock and cryptocurrency trading platform. This application uses AI algorithms for customer support and provides personalized investment recommendations. For this, the app employs machine learning to enhance the user experience and optimize trading strategies.

3. ZestFinance

ZestFinance is one of the leading fintech companies in the USA. They also utilize artificial intelligence and machine learning to improve credit underwriting. The company provides AI-driven credit scoring solutions to assess the credit risk of individuals who may not have a traditional credit history.

4. Capital One

This fintech company applies AI and machine learning for credit card fraud detection and risk management. They use AI models to analyze spending patterns, identify anomalies, and enhance the security of their financial services.

5. Ant Financial (Alibaba Group)

Ant Financial is an affiliate of Alibaba Group. They use AI and ML in finance for their mobile payment platform Alipay. They employ advanced algorithms for fraud detection, and credit scoring, and give personalized financial product recommendations.

Blockchain Allows new Business Models:

Blockchain, a recent invention, is being used in more and more different Fintech applications, but it has not yet seen mainstream retail acceptance. A blockchain is a collection of blocks that store information with timestamps in hash functions such that the information cannot be modified or tampered with. It gives the products an edge of blockchain technology in the sense where it is possible to swap most of the trust-providing proxies from the standard Fintech.

Technology dependence not only brings cost savings but can allow the development of entirely new business models that are unheard of in the current financial ecosystem because of technical debt and obscurantism or simply prohibition of costs. It is just a beginning to peer micropayments between users, insurance, or loan products directly provided between retail users bypassing rating agencies and other proxies. Innovation is also hitting government levels in the form of Central Bank Digital Currencies. Some countries are looking at how to introduce robust crypto-secured digital currencies at the national level.
